Field Leveling in Salt Lake City, UT
Field le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s terrain to create a more even and stable surface. This process is commonly used for preparing land for construction projects, establishing a level foundation for driveways, patios, or lawns, and correcting uneven or sloping ground caused by natural settling or erosion. Property owners typically request this service to improve drainage, prevent water pooling, or to ensure a safe, functional outdoor space. Understanding the extent of the unevenness, the type of soil, and the desired final grade can help property owners determine if field leveling is the right solution for their needs.
Before requesting field leveling services,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size of the area and the degree of elevation change. It’s also helpful to know if there are any existing structures, underground utilities, or landscaping features that could influence the work. Clear communication about the desired outcome, such as a flat yard or a specific slope for drainage, can assist in planning the project effectively. Proper assessment and planning ensure the land is prepared to meet both functional and aesthetic goals.

Field Leveling Questions
What is field leveling? Field leveling is the process of smoothing and adjusting uneven ground surfaces to create a stable, even area for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ements.
What types of projects benefit from field leveling? Projects such as installing patios, building foundations, grading yards, or preparing land for landscaping often require field leveling services.
How does field leveling improve property safety? Proper leveling reduces the risk of uneven surfaces that can cause trips, falls, or drainage issues, enhancing overall property safety and usability.
What should property owners consider before a field leveling project? It’s important to assess existing ground conditions, drainage needs, and future use plans to determine the scope of leveling required.
